Well, the only way I found this was I am selling a Seaver rookie (PSA 7) out here on the Forum and have been tracking sales.....When this listing popped up, I hit the watch button - never really looked too close at that time - and then got notification when it sold....it went really cheap....$760 for a Seaver Rookie PSA 7?
https://www.ebay.com/itm/15529199678...Bk9SR8rF2LecYQ Problem is the Seller has ZERO feedback and is in Cyprus? I know there are a lot of Seaver fans out, but how many in Cyprus?? LOL... The other thing I noticed that was odd was the back of the PSA case had a sticker with 1700 penned on it.....I remember there was another Seaver PSA 7 on this forum that recently sold that had that sticker and when I went and pulled it up, sure enough....its the card.... Scammer clipped the photos off of here and listed on ebay... https://www.net54baseball.com/showthread.php?t=327042 I hope no one here bought this card.....off of ebay that is...
